Current Status of Bill HR 4986

Bill HR 4986 is currently in the status of Bill Introduced since July 27, 2023. Bill HR 4986 was introduced during Congress 118 and was introduced to the House on July 27, 2023.  Bill HR 4986's most recent activity was Referred to the Committee on Education and the Workforce, and in addition to the Committee on the Budget, for a period to be subsequently determined by the Speaker, in each case for consideration of such provisions as fall within the jurisdiction of the committee concerned. as of July 27, 2023

Alternate Title(s) of Bill HR 4986

Student Loan Interest Elimination Act
Student Loan Interest Elimination Act
To amend the Higher Education Act of 1965 to eliminate interest on student loans, establish the Education Affordability Trust Fund, increase annual and aggregate loan limits, and for other purposes.
